IP查询
查询
你查询的IP:[59.191.10.51] 地理位置:中国–广东
最新查询
123.1.128.208
218.249.154.155
58.192.169.45
202.112.223.145
124.112.11.12
122.64.123.126
219.244.191.115
114.54.205.193
123.101.82.67
59.191.10.51
203.156.192.161
202.36.176.161
203.135.160.52
114.54.206.105
202.63.248.193
202.10.64.168
116.224.81.120
210.32.170.65
117.128.247.78
123.137.250.27
203.94.51.106
120.94.222.200
121.248.184.147
220.152.128.3
202.123.96.37
125.31.192.244
58.82.18.226
219.242.230.14
61.4.176.171
124.68.105.60
221.224.146.145